Cairns 2050 Shared Vision
The Cairns 2050 Shared Vision provides the foundation for our advocacy initiatives. As the principal hub for economic activity in Far North Queensland, Cairns provides the region’s major employment area, tourism and development arena and community heart.
Developed in tandem with key stakeholders, the Cairns 2050 Shared Vision seeks to position Cairns as the World’s Most Liveable and Enterprising Regional City, built upon the natural setting, existing quality of life and established character of the city.
The shared vision provides a framework as well as the individual projects, investment and policy changes necessary to deliver on that objective.
